Considering that The Simpsons is a satirical comedy, I don't think young children should be watching it because they don't understand satire. They're too young to really comprehend what a parody is and thus not only will they miss the point of the show/humour, they can also misconstrue the information being relayed to them as proper behaviour. I don't necessarily think that watching The Simpsons at a young age will ruin you for life, but why take the chance.
